At AMN Healthcare, we recognize the vital role that Psychologist Allied professionals play in the educational ecosystem of Bridgeport, Connecticut. In this vibrant city, psychologists working in schools can expect to engage in a diverse range of responsibilities that contribute to the academic and emotional well-being of students. These dedicated professionals will work collaboratively with educators, parents, and multidisciplinary teams to assess student needs, develop and implement individualized intervention plans, and provide counseling services aimed at enhancing social skills and coping strategies. Additionally, psychologists may conduct workshops and training sessions for staff, ensuring a supportive and inclusive environment for all students, particularly those facing mental health challenges. Most travel psychologist positions in Bridgeport typically require experience in clinical psychology, including assessments and therapeutic interventions, as well as familiarity with various therapeutic modalities. Additionally, candidates often need prior experience working in diverse settings or with different populations to effectively adapt to the varied environments they may encounter while traveling.
In Bridgeport, travel positions for psychologist professionals in schools are typically available at educational institutions such as public and private schools, as well as specialized facilities like behavioral health centers and educational agencies focused on student mental health. These settings often seek psychologists to provide support and assessment services, particularly during times of increased demand or staff shortages.
Common specialties for psychologists working travel jobs in Bridgeport, Connecticut, include clinical psychology, which focuses on diagnosing and treating mental health issues, and counseling psychology, which emphasizes providing therapy and support for personal and interpersonal challenges. Additionally, psychologists may specialize in areas such as child psychology, catering to the unique needs of younger populations, or neuropsychology, assessing and treating cognitive and behavioral effects of neurological conditions.
